AnnaMaria DeSalva is the global Chairman and CEO of Hill+Knowlton Strategies. She is a business leader and corporate affairs expert known for creating step changes in growth and reputation at leading innovative companies and global communications services firms.

Before joining H+K in June 2019 AnnaMaria served as Chief Communications Officer of E.I. du Pont de Nemours amp; Co. (DuPont) from 2014-2018 and subsequently as a senior advisor to Ed Breen the CEO of DowDuPont as he advanced the separation and launch of new independent public companies.   During her tenure AnnaMaria restructured the communications function establishing new standards and protocols to reduce reputation risk and improve performance while ensuring the company successfully navigated a series of special situations demanding highly sensitive and effective public strategies including a proxy battle with an activist shareholder; a CEO transition; and the $130 billion merger of equals with Dow leading to the subsequent break-up and creation of three new industry-leading companies.

Prior to her tenure at DuPont AnnaMaria led corporate affairs for the innovative core of Pfizer where she played a principal role in the integration of Pfizers $68 billion acquisition of Wyeth and the turnaround of Ramp;D.  Earlier she served as the global practice leader of healthcare at Hill amp; Knowlton and GCI Group both WPP companies delivering significant revenue growth for each firm. At Bristol-Myers Squibb DeSalva led international public affairs in oncology working principally in Europe and later became director of the Bristol-Myers Squibb Foundation.

AnnaMaria currently serves as Vice Chairman of the board of directors of XPO Logistics (NYSE: XPO) a technology-driven Fortune 200 global provider of transportation and supply chain solutions and as a member of the Board of Governors of Argonne National Laboratory a leading science and engineering center of the U.S. Department of Energy.

Richard is Global President of Hill+Knowlton Strategies and CEO of the Americas with responsibility for driving innovation and business transformation across geographies sectors and services.

Prior to his current role Richard was CEO of H+Ks flagship London operation from 2008 to 2018. During that time he reorganized the agency around a client-centric depth and breadth agenda diversifying the agencys capabilities and launching new products and services.  This transformation agenda resulted in seven consecutive years of record growth an embedded creative culture and the agency recognized as UK Agency of the Year. Under his direction this program is now being adapted and implemented globally.

Richard leads a number of the firms global client relationships. Among these is adidas with whom he has a relationship stretching back to the agencys appointment in 1993.  He cites his clients restless desire for ideas and innovation for cultural relevance as context for his ambitions for H+K.

In a seven-year period between his two terms at the agency Richard held a number of marketing and trading positions with a European retailer serving latterly as Marketing Director Europe.

Richard is graduate of the University of Manchester a Fellow of the Royal Society of Arts and Trustee of Generation Success – an organization that champions social mobility and diversity across the professional services industries.

Simon is Global Chief Creative Strategy + Innovation Officer of Hill+Knowlton Strategies leading the creative + innovation agenda globally both with clients and across the agencys sectors and specialisms.

Simon joined H+K as Chief Creative Officer in 2014 to lead the transformation of the London agency working alongside the CEO. Through a program of cultural and business change a new agency positioning was introduced along with the development of new processes specialisms and skills. In 2017 after three years of top and bottom line growth London was awarded the Holmes Report UK Agency of the Year and in 2018 Pan-EMEA won Consultancy of the Year. 
 
A part of the transformation Simon has also led the creation of the H+K Shanghai Addition a bridge for Chinese clients to the rest of the H+K network. Simon currently spend around 1 week in 6 in China working with Chinese clients including Huawei Wanda Envision Sunning and Honor. 
 
Prior to joining H+K Simon has held multiple creative leadership positions. He is a well-renowned and respected industry authority speaking and serving as judge at the Cannes Lions and as President on Damp;AD jury. In 2019 Simon was ranked one of the top 10 creative leaders by PR Week. 
 
Simon is an awarded architect with architectural degrees from the University of Edinburgh and University College of London.

As Global Chair Public Affairs Philippe leads H+Ks global public affairs capabilities to benefit clients working closely with the firms leadership and teams around the world. He has worked for more than 25 years on policy issues and with governments in Africa Europe India the Middle East and North America helping business leaders anticipate and navigate public policy challenges to protect and enhance their license to operate. His experience at the intersection of public policy government relations and strategic communications spans the aerospace agriculture and food energy defense mining public health pharmaceutical and tech sectors.

Philippe joined H+K from McLarty Associates a leading global strategic business advisory firm where he served in leadership positions in the firms Brussels and DC offices. At McLarty he advised clients on major transatlantic trade matters; international market entry; government approvals of global mergers; government affairs challenges posed by sanctions regimes; and he implemented strategies in each area. Previously Philippe served as Executive Director in the Washington office of APCO Worldwide where he led APCOs global government relations practice. Earlier in his tenure at APCO he served as managing director of the Brussels office; oversaw operations in India the Middle East and Africa; and ran the Paris office.

Prior to joining APCO Philippe worked for the spirits division of the French luxury group LVMH in France and Germany; for the office of the United Nations High Commissioner for Human Rights in Geneva; and at the delegation of the European Commission in Washington DC.

A dual French and American citizen Philippe holds a master of science in foreign service from Georgetown University and a master of arts in law (Cantab) from Cambridge University. During the course of his studies he spent one year at the University of Bonn in Germany as a Konrad Adenauer fellow. He is fluent in French English and German.

As Global Chair of Corporate Affairs Kelli Parsons leads the firms expertise across corporate brand and reputation financial communications crisis and issues management employee engagement and change management and ESG strategies. She provides strategic communication counsel and services to strengthen reputation and brand equity through periods of large-scale change such as 9/11 the Great Recession and the resulting decade of business transformation. Kelli particularly enjoys partnering with CCOs and advising executive teams and boards of directors to build stakeholder trust and create business and societal value in defining moments.

Most recently as Chief Communications Officer at United Technologies Kelli created the multi-stakeholder communication strategy for the companys transformation including its integration of Rockwell Collins spins of Carrier and Otis and $74 billion merger with Raytheon while managing complex geopolitical issues.

As CCO of Fannie Mae following the financial crisis Kelli rebuilt trust and reputation during the historic turnaround of the $3 trillion housing finance company. She authored the strategy and message to foster purpose among employees and communicate the companys progress to policy makers and regulators investors and consumers for which her team was awarded PRWeek Team of the Year.

Earlier in her career Kelli led H+Ks US corporate practice the firms largest global client relationship and its New York and Washington offices through financial and cultural transformation.

Beginning her career as a television news reporter Kellis assignments included U.S. presidential campaigns the humanitarian crisis in Bosnia and Hurricane Andrew.

Kelli earned a masters degree from Northwestern University Medill School of Journalism. She serves on the executive committee of the Page Society board of trustees.

Simon is the UK CEO of H+K.

Simon is a specialist in corporate communications international public affairs financial PR and litigation communications. In addition to his role as CEO of H+K London Simon oversees H+Ks global energy and industrials business working across oil and gas traditional and new energy mining transport infrastructure and logistics. In 2018 his team was awarded Energy Consultancy of the Year at the Petroleum Economist Awards. Key clients have included Shell Dong Energy IOGP Statoil E.ON GE Oilamp;Gas/Baker Hughes Anglo American DHL ICMM Ford DP World and Hitachi.  

Previously Simon was a partner at College Hill leading the energy and natural resources team and co-leading the emerging markets business across Russia/CIS Africa and India. At College Hill Simon managed the financial PR for many oil gas and natural resources companies; he won a SABRE award for his work with the Royal Bafokeng Nation and a PRCA award for best financial communicator for his work with Landkom. Before that he was European director of emerging markets for APCO Worldwide working with clients such as Yukos Oil the Alfa Group and President Yushchenko of Ukraine.   

Simon has an MA (Hons) from Cambridge University an MBA from Cranfield School of Management and a Diploma from the Chartered Institute of Marketing. Simon has lived and worked in the U.S. Japan Germany and Russia.
